What companies run services between Newcastle Airport (NCL), England and Scotch Corner, England?

There is no direct connection from Newcastle Airport (NCL) to Scotch Corner. However, you can take the subway to Central Station, walk to Newcastle, take the train to Darlington, then take the taxi to Scotch Corner. Alternatively, Mozio operates a vehicle from Newcastle-NCL to Scotch Corner on demand, and the journey takes 50 min.
